A STUNNING MANCHESTER WEDDING WITH A GREAT CAUSE!

When Wynne and Jung first got in touch with me about their Chinese wedding in Manchester, I was so excited – they were planning a stylish religious wedding with a church ceremony, with lots of personal touches and even a Chinese tea serving ceremony. Wynne and Jung are the loveliest people and I couldn’t wait to shoot their wedding!

The excitement before the wedding

I rocked up at the Manchester hotel, where the bride and her friends were getting ready together, and it was really chilled, because everyone was in a good mood. Wynne wore a stunning lace patterned dress for the ceremony and Jung wore a modern blue suit and blush pink tie and they looked so incredible. Wynne had several dress changes throughout the day which is quite traditional of a Chinese wedding and each one was as stunning as the next.

The ceremony

The wedding took place at Christ Church, Manchester, and was a stunning church ceremony. They had some beautiful readings, which was just magical. They both smiled throughout the ceremony as their guests watched on matching their expressions.After the ceremony we did confetti outside the church door, and then the celebrations began. With more than 200 guests it was a challenge to get a group shot of everyone but it looked amazing at the front of the church.

The reception

The wedding reception took place at The Message Enterprise Centre, which is a Centre opened in 2012 and is providing a holistic solution for men and women leaving prison and rehabilitation who are serious about making a new start. It was the perfect place for their wedding as they wanted to hire a venue that would put the money to good use.

It was a beautifully sunny day, which was perfect for photos. While the guests enjoyed canapés and drinks, we took a little detour to a local park for some natural portraits. My favourite photo from our portrait session is from the colour gardens where they had some times to themselves to let it all sink in.

During the reception they had a photobooth, which everyone loved. For the wedding breakfast they had some delicious Chinese dishes, and it was so yummy. After dinner they went straight into the first dance, then everyone hit the dancefloor and partied into the night as the sunset. The dance moves that came out that evening were ones to remember!I don't think I've come across a group who can dance so well.
